    I wouldn't resort to hyperbole, but the app is kinda problematic for me.

    Firstly, I can never get it to connect to Wi-fi without first connecting via cable. After it connects to Wi-Fi once, it works fine...until,

    Secondly, whether the artboard I'm looking at will update is a dice roll at best.

    Lastly, I find myself opening it 2-3 times as much as I should, as quitting and restarting the app seems to be the only way to get it to refresh sometimes.

    I still use it though. When it works, it definitely helps. But, yeah, it's problematic. I guess I don't sit around cursing its name, is all.
